LM Wind Power Aims for Carbon Neutrality by 2018

Wind turbine blade manufacturer LM Wind Power plans to be carbon neutral by 2018, with the fist step on the path to carbon neutrality being sourcing 100% of its electricity from renewable energy sources, mainly wind, from 2017 onward. VIDEO: Offshore Blade Installation in Virtual World

Siemens has developed a simulation tool which allows its technicians to practice installing blades on offshore wind turbines prior to heading out on live projects. Hywind Buoyant on French Connection

French cable maker Nexans has awarded its compatriot, Bardot Group, with a contract to supply buoyancy modules for the power cables of Hywind Scotland, the world’s first floating wind farm. Ming Yang and China Three Gorges Reaffirm Guangdong Offshore Wind Ties

Wind turbine maker Ming Yang Wind Power and the energy company China Three Gorges Group have signed a new agreement to cooperate on offshore wind projects in Guangdong, China’s province on the South China Sea coast. Block Island Turbine Out of Action Until Second Half of February

One of the General Elecetric’s (GE) Haliade turbines installed at America’s first offshore wind farm will be out of action at least until the second half of February, according to a statement issued by Block Island Wind Farm’s Fisheries Liaison, Elizabeth Ann Marchetti. ORE Catapult Seeks Grid Emulation System Provider

Offshore Renewable Energy (ORE) Catapult is seeking a contractor that can design, supply, deliver, install, test and commission a Grid Emulation System including cabling and containment at its test facility in Blyth, Northumberland, UK. Babcock Deploys FORECAST LiDAR off Aberdeen

UK-based engineering support services company Babcock has deployed its floating LiDAR (light detection and ranging) technology to provide offshore wind data to the proposed Aberdeen offshore wind farm, also known as the European Offshore Wind Deployment Centre (EOWDC). Fraunhofer IWES Secures Funds for Offshore Wind Turbine Test Field

German Federal Ministry for Economic Affairs and Energy (BMWi) has awarded Fraunhofer IWES with an EUR 18.5 million grant for the development of an offshore wind turbine test field in Bremerhaven. DONG Orders Granada Cranes for Hornsea One

Rochdale-based Granada Material Handling Limited (Granada) is the latest UK firm to sign a contract with DONG Energy for the world’s biggest wind farm, the 1.2GW Hornsea Project One located some 120 kilometres off Yorkshire. Bureau Veritas Issues Guidelines for De-Risking Floating Wind Projects

International classification society Bureau Veritas has published a set of guidelines to reduce and manage risk as ocean engineering requirements develop in the growing marine renewable energy sector.
